Agreement made to request development proposals for former Seneca property

(ABC 6 News) – The Olmsted County Board of Commissioners recently signed an agreement to have Rochester Area Economic Development serve as the county’s redevelopment consultant for the Seneca Property owned by the county.

RAEDI will partner with the county to develop and execute a Statement of Interest process to solicit development proposals and evaluate the highest and best use, with RAEDI providing expertise and capacity to the county.

“This agreement combines our organizational strengths to advance a significant development opportunity. We look forward to working with Olmsted County to make that happen,” said RAEDI President John Wade.

"The board is interested in seeing how it will compliment Graham park in some way. The other is just the county board is interest in any and all ideas that the development community maybe interested in so they want to keep all of their options open to see what the potential development opportunities are," said Olmsted County Deputy Administrator Pete Giesen.

The process will be open-ended and transparent at the discretion of the county and all decisions regarding any development to take place on the site will be at the county’s discretion.

The SOI process will begin in March 2022 and be completed in July 2022.
